Preservica Redefines Digital Preservation with Powerful Built-In AI Tools
OXFORD, UK and BOSTON, MA / ACCESS Newswire (https://www.accessnewswire.com/)
/ February 4, 2026 / Preservica (https://pr.report/ibbv) , the leader in
AI-powered Active Digital Preservation™ (https://pr.report/ibbw) , today
announced the rollout of integrated, human-centered AI tools and flexible AI
Credits across its product editions. These new features make AI assistance a
seamless part of everyday archival workflows, empowering organizations of all
sizes to safely adopt AI and scale its use as their needs grow.

Trusted, human-centered AI
Preservica's AI features are securely integrated into the existing platform
and workflows, fully tested, supported and aligned with current AI regulations
and standards. Administrators can easily control where and how AI is applied,
switching it off or limiting its use to specific collections. Transparent data
processing and detailed audit trails eliminate the complexity and risks of
piecing together standalone open-source tools. Professional Plus &
Enterprise editions also offer secure APIs for organizations that prefer to
use their own AI models and tooling.

Quality check & standardize metadata in minutes
Clean up metadata from multiple sources, auto populate empty fields, resolve
inconsistencies and accelerate backlog reduction.
Identify files containing PII for compliance with open data & privacy laws
Quickly and confidently identify files containing Personally Identifiable
Information (PII) to support privacy, compliance and responsible record
sharing.
Enhance the discoverability of scanned images through OCR
Transform scanned and digitized materials into fully searchable, defensible
& compliant assets using built-in Optical Character Recognition (OCR).
Categorize & describe image collections at scale
Automatically detect people, places, and objects to streamline metadata
creation for large image collections, enabling rapid categorization of image
backlogs.
Automate the transcription and captioning of AV assets
Save hours of time by generating accurate transcripts and captions in minutes
to meet accessibility standards and improve navigation with timestamped text.
Semantic search for intent-based discovery
Help users find relevant records faster, surface under described content and
respond quickly to audits, FOI requests, eDiscovery needs and compliance
inquiries.
Availability for customers
PII detection and OCR tools are available now across supported Preservica
editions, as well as AI credits which are consumed based on the usage of AI
services. New AI-driven capabilities for automated appraisal and transfer of
content from SharePoint and deeper discovery experiences using Microsoft
Copilot are in development with more updates coming soon.
